Raisin Bread
March 9th, 2010 · 17 Comments
The single batch of dough yields two medium loaves or one medium loaf and four mini loaves. This bread is similar to most of the cinnamon raisin breads you will find in stores today, and slightly larger than the typical, and great toasted with some butter, or even cream cheese smeared on top. Of course, plain is just as wonderful too, with the dark and golden raisins, cinnamon, and sugar spiraled loaf; any slice is just plain goodness.
